Good question. I tell you what I did and then you tell me if I did test!

So I did this: I did write a small C program that does contain a small
byte buffer and the extracted CRC32 logic from the wlan driver.
The program does calculate the CRC32 sum with the extracted logic and by
calling crc32_le function. but values are the same.

But as I don't own the hardware I couldn't do a real test with WEP (as
far as I understand only WEP on this hardware would be affected.)

So a better test would be to find someone which actually owns the
hardware and could test the change.
